Transaction 52a5f22780ae7cf731bb27942ba751556988e383df0ac57fd9a291f8a4df7a9e
1 Input
1 Output
-
52a5f22780ae7cf731bb27942ba751556988e383df0ac57fd9a291f8a4df7a9e:0
- value
- 388913
- script pubkey
- OP_0 OP_PUSHBYTES_32 65a73074a008cf10a73eafd91a72553d6fdaf0e9387e320c260c30a7daa22564
- address
- bc1qvknnqa9qpr83pfe74lv35uj484ha4u8f8plryrpxpsc20k4zy4jqt3rvry